The Monroe Township Recycling Drop off Center, located off Park Road next to the municipal building, accepts newspaper, office paper, chip board, steel cans, magazines/catalogs/glossy inserts, corrugated cardboard, aluminum cans; brown, green and clear glass bottles & jars only, no ceramics or window glass, and #1 & #2 plastics only (this would be laundry detergent bottles and plastic bottles only; NOT rigid plastic, PVC pipes, cups or clam shell food containers, pails, buckets, kitty litter pails, toys, garbage cans, plastic bags.) The number can be found on the bottom of the bottle and it will say #1 or #2 with the recycling symbol around it. Please be considerate of the rules as there is an actual person sorting these items when they are taken to the recycling center. Note: One wrong/dirty item in the container can contaminate the entire load.
We are noticing cat food cans, among other items, are not being rinsed out. Please be considerate of the township workers and rinse out cans as they smell in the summer and are unable to be recycled.

Compost Site
Monroe Township has a place to bring tree and shrub waste. Allowed items are tree stumps with no roots or root bulb, wood should be no wider than 4 feet and no longer than 10 feet. The tree and shrub waste will be made into mulch for residential use, so please no weeds, grass, household wood, or rubbish.
